View Single Post
  #5   Report Post  
Posted to microsoft.public.excel.programming
jayklmno jayklmno is offline
external usenet poster
 
Posts: 58
Default Checking user defined types for Nothing

This user defined type is an array. Ubound works normally on this if it is
intialized, but since it's not been intialized, how do I test that?

"Chip Pearson" wrote:

UBound is used only for arrays, not user defined types.


--
Cordially,
Chip Pearson
Microsoft MVP - Excel
Pearson Software Consulting, LLC
www.cpearson.com


"jayklmno" wrote in message
...
When I check an element, like ubound() I get a subscript error
and it tells
me ubound(UDT) = nothing.

Is there a way to phrase the ubound statement that won't bomb
out the code?

"Tom Ogilvy" wrote:

You would have to check the individual elements I would think.

a UDT is not an object, so is nothing wouldn't work.

--
Regards,
Tom Ogilvy



"jayklmno" wrote:

I have a user defined type that is not getting initialized
under a certain
procedure and when it gets to a point, I need to check and
see if it has been
initialized. I acnnot get any combination of Is Nothing,
IsNull or anything
else I can think of to get it to discover if the UDT =
Nothing.

Any suggestions?